Factors to Consider When Choosing a Charcoal Grill With Rotisserie

You should start by matching the grill’s size and capacity to the amount of food you’ll cook, then check that the rotisserie motor’s power can handle the weight of your meats. Look for sturdy construction materials and an efficient ash‑management system to keep performance consistent and cleanup easy. Finally, consider how portable the unit is if you plan to move it around your backyard or take it on trips.
Grill Size & Capacity
Choosing the right grill size and capacity means matching the cooking surface to your typical crew and menu. If you usually feed four to six people, aim for a 400‑600 sq in. cooking area; larger families or weekend gatherings may need 700 sq in. or more. Consider the shape: square or rectangular grills give you longer linear space for side‑by‑side steaks, while round models maximize central heat for rotisserie. Check the grill’s height clearance; a taller barrel accommodates larger birds without crowding the firebox. Remember that a bigger grill consumes more charcoal and takes longer to heat, so balance volume with fuel efficiency. Finally, verify that the rotisserie rod fits comfortably within the cooking area without obstructing grill racks or flare‑ups.
Rotisserie Motor Power
When you select a charcoal grill with a rotisserie, pay close attention to the motor’s power rating, because it determines how smoothly and reliably the meat will turn. A 30‑60 watt motor handles most roasts, chickens, and small pigs, but if you plan to spin heavier cuts—up to 150 lb—look for a 60‑watt or higher motor. Adjustable‑speed models let you dial in the perfect rotation rate for size and weight, preventing over‑spinning or sluggish movement. Brushless DC motors are quieter, last longer, and waste less energy than traditional AC units. Aim for a motor that delivers 3‑4 rpm, the sweet spot for even browning and juicy results. These specifications guarantee consistent performance without straining the grill’s power.
Construction Material Quality
If durability matters, focus on the grill’s construction material, because stainless steel and cast iron withstand high heat and resist corrosion, while enameled steel adds a smooth, easy‑to‑clean surface without sacrificing strength. You’ll want a heavy‑duty powder‑coated steel frame for rust protection and weather resistance, especially if the grill sits outdoors year‑round. Aluminum parts can lighten the unit, making it easier to move without compromising overall sturdiness. Look for robust joints and reinforced corners; they keep the grill stable while the rotisserie turns heavy meats. A solid build also means fewer warps over time, preserving heat distribution and cooking performance. Choose materials that balance strength, maintenance ease, and longevity for reliable backyard grilling.
Ash Management System
A good ash management system keeps your grill tidy and your cooking uninterrupted. You’ll want a detachable ash collector that slides out quickly, letting you dump ash without fuss. Look for a built‑in tray or drawer that catches debris as it falls, so you won’t have to scrape the grate after every session. Some models feature a hinged pan that flips open for easy emptying, which saves time and keeps the grill’s airflow intact. The key is removing ash without disassembling anything—this preserves the grate’s lifespan and maintains consistent temperature control. A well‑engineered system also prevents clogs, ensuring steady heat and reliable rotisserie performance throughout your cook.
Portability & Mobility
Because you’ll likely move your grill from backyard to campsite or tailgate, portability and mobility become key factors in choosing a charcoal grill with a rotisserie. Look for lockable casters; they let you roll the grill smoothly and lock it in place when you’re ready to fire up. Foldable legs and a compact footprint make storage and transport a breeze, especially when you’re loading a car trunk or roof rack. Lightweight materials such as stainless or or enameled steel reduce overall weight without sacrificing durability. Detachable components—spit rods, rotisserie motors, side shelves—let you break the unit down into smaller pieces, fitting tighter spaces and easing setup. Prioritizing these features guarantees you can enjoy rotisserie cooking wherever your adventures take you.
